2. Threats And Possible Difficulties



The threats and complications of Lasik eye surgery are a vital part of recognizing the procedure prior to deciding whether it is right for you. It is very important to be familiar with the potential threats and problems associated with this type of eye surgical treatment, so that you can make an enlightened decision regarding your vision health and wellness.

Lasik eye surgery has a number of prospective risks and difficulties. These consist of completely dry eyes, infection, swelling, overcorrection or undercorrection, halos or starbursts around lights during the night, and rising and fall vision. In uncommon situations, even more serious problems such as corneal ectasia or retinal detachment can happen. In addition, some people may not be qualified for the treatment due to their general eye health or various other clinical conditions.

It is necessary to discuss any kind of worry about an eye doctor or eye doctor prior to going through Lasik eye surgical treatment. The doctor will analyze your viability for the procedure and describe all possible threats in order to aid you make an educated decision concerning your vision care.
